Goga Ashkenazi takes full control of Vionnet
Nov 9, 2012
Originally of French origin and revived by the Italians in 2009, Vionnet is now entirely owned by GoTo Enterprise, headed by Gogo Ashkenazi. The London-based Kazakhstani billionaire bought the controlling share of Vionnet in May, demoting former owners, Matteo Marzotto and his associates, to minority shareholders and has now bought out the remaining shares of the company. Her interest in the brand apparently stems from a Vionnet dress she had seen in a Cannes showroom in May, where she also met the brand’s owner, Matteo Marzotto.

Since taking control of Vionnet, Gogo Ashykenazi broke ties with the labels two creative directors who only started with the brand at the end of 2011. From the presentation of Vionnet’s semi-couture capsule collection in Paris in September, it seems like the CEO has been trying to up the hype around the label. According to the press release, Gogo Ashkenazi is not only majority shareholder but also creative director of Vionnet.
